Adapting: The Future of Jewish Education

Episode 9: Gen Z: Reshaping Jewish Life

03 Dec 2020

Description

What do teens do when a pandemic interrupts plans for prom, graduation, or college?  Is discussing social issues and Jewish texts the same over Zoom as a classroom? Abe Baker-Butler, Alyx Bernstein,  Sydney Greene, and Julie Levey discuss  their social and emotional lives, their visions for Jewish life, and the actions they are taking to create a better future with The Jewish Education Project's Jodie Goldberg and David Bryfman. Access the shownotes for this episode and watch the LIVEcast recording here. This episode was recorded on  July 15, 2020. Adapting is produced in partnership with   jewishLIVE. Learn more about  The Jewish Education Project.
